DC Superior Court Judge Danya Dayson heard testimony from a detective regarding the victim’s recollection of a shooting incident during a March 21 hearing. 

Tyshay Moore, 27, and Javonee Jackson, 25, are charged with assault with intent to kill while armed, four counts of possession of a firearm during crime of violence, aggravated assault knowingly while armed, assault with a dangerous weapon, assault with significant bodily injury while armed, conspiracy, and simple assault for her alleged involvement in a shooting that injured one individual. The incident occurred on May 10, 2023, on the 700 Block of 7th Street, NW. 

A Metropolitan Police Department (MPD) detective testified that he was the individual who went to interview the victim two days after the incident. 

During the interview, the witness testified that the victim knew his assailants prior to the incident and had a child with Jackson. The victim also allegedly stated that his child’s mother’s ex-girlfriend, Moore,  was also one of the people who assaulted him, but could not confirm who shot him. 

According to the detective, the victim had video proof of the altercation, stating that the video shows Jackson, Moore, and another unidentified person assaulting him. 

The defense began their cross examination but was stopped short due to time. Judge Dayson scheduled the motion hearing to continue on April 10 in order for the defense to finish their cross examination. 

Trial is slated to begin on April 15.
